Transaction 3c22a1b0c97890ad0e3cae49bb62ad3eb846153e00986f66d0d50b108aa54ebe
1 Input
1 Output
-
3c22a1b0c97890ad0e3cae49bb62ad3eb846153e00986f66d0d50b108aa54ebe:0
- value
- 9766196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376f5554424f12edee5520027d64ab860f55c OP_EQUAL
- address
- 3BMEXuebWEM4yV7xsTnD1oj53N6ZEgBDPS